Project Director, District Rural Development Cell, Bankura
Tenzin Semkyi Ogen, born on 12 February 1994, is an Indian Administrative Service officer of the 2021 batch, allocated to the West Bengal cadre. She holds a B.A. in Economics Honours from Miranda House, University of Delhi. Currently, she serves as the Project Director at Bankura in the District Rural Development Cell since 30 March 2026. Her previous roles include Joint Secretary and Sub Divisional Officer. Tenzin Semkyi Ogen continues to serve in the Indian Administrative Service, contributing to rural development initiatives in West Bengal.
